Transaction ff70751d59784b6aafd1c685a978c320bc6ef0dc584e9ee793aeb7e36c914ab1

5 Input
2 Outputs
  • ff70751d59784b6aafd1c685a978c320bc6ef0dc584e9ee793aeb7e36c914ab1:0
  • value  32750993
    address  16Z4wtud8MXRYeKZWWoNF2eRbkgojzEroT
  • ff70751d59784b6aafd1c685a978c320bc6ef0dc584e9ee793aeb7e36c914ab1:1
  • value  21415472
    address  3DptinDt5dCd9fxsFRuif2iu3HTYAzNmwH